Located on L’Isle-aux-Coudres, Les Traverseux offers an exceptional site on the maritime history of the St. Lawrence islands, featuring the ice canoe, from necessity to today’s competition. There’s a space reserved for the schooner and its artifacts to visit; a resto-bistro-bar, two terraces, a boutique and a stage for storytellers and emerging artists.
You can enjoy an ice-canoeing school and outings on the river in all four seasons. In winter, there’s a riverside snowshoe trail, fat-bike, ice canoe and ice ring.
